According to observations of A.P. Belyaev, echinococcal fluid, filtered through Schamberlend's candle and preserved in sealed ampoules for a long time, at least 16 months, has the ability to give a positive reaction when injected intradermally in echinococcal patients, namely, when 0.3-0.5 of this fluid is injected into the skin, a blister appears at the injection site, surrounded by a reddened area and sometimes infiltrate.
